Dr. Szarabajko headshotDr. Alexandra Szarabajko, Program Chair and Assistant Professor of Exercise Science at Columbia College, completed her doctorate last summer at Oregon State University. Her dissertation work, entitled “Are Tertiary Institutions Losing Sight of their Duty to Cura Personalis?” was recently published in Research Quarterly for Exercise and Sport. Since publication, Dr. Szarabajko’s research has been cited in media coverage across the nation, including:

At Columbia College, she is working with her undergraduate students to examine the status of physical education requirements in South Carolina’s colleges and universities.
